RZ/{G2L,V2L} and RZ/G2LC SoC use the same carrier board, but the SoM is
different.

Different pin mapping is possible on SoM. For eg:- RZ/G2L SMARC EVK
uses SCIF2, whereas RZ/G2LC uses SCIF1 for the serial interface available
on PMOD1. Like wise CAN1 is multiplexed with SCIF1 using SW1[3] or RSPI
using SW1[4].

This patch series adds support for handling the pin mapping differences 
by moving definitions common to RZ/G2L and RZ/G2LC to a common dtsi file.
